Warning: file_get_contents(/data/phpspider/zhask/data//catemap/4/unix/3.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
如何从主机访问docker容器中的目录?_Docker_Dockerfile - Fatal编程技术网

如何从主机访问docker容器中的目录?

如何从主机访问docker容器中的目录?,docker,dockerfile,Docker,Dockerfile,我的主机中有一个docker wildFly容器运行在127.0.0.1:8089上。我想将其作为testng/arquilian测试的默认应用程序服务器 Earlier : -DWILDFLY_HOME=/Users/abdulrazak/dev/wildfly/devsetup/wildfly-8.1.0.Final 我在本地使用wildfly实例作为默认值,我想将其更改为docker wildlfy实例 CONTAINER ID IMAGE CO

我的主机中有一个docker wildFly容器运行在127.0.0.1:8089上。我想将其作为testng/arquilian测试的默认应用程序服务器

Earlier : -DWILDFLY_HOME=/Users/abdulrazak/dev/wildfly/devsetup/wildfly-8.1.0.Final
我在本地使用wildfly实例作为默认值,我想将其更改为docker wildlfy实例

CONTAINER ID        IMAGE               COMMAND                  CREATED             STATUS              PORTS                              NAMES
70eb157707ac        my_test_wildfly     "container-entrypo..."   26 minutes ago      Up 28 minutes       9990/tcp, 0.0.0.0:8090->8080/tcp   vibrant_cori

如何将docker容器上的wildFly目录作为我的wildFly_主页路径?

据我所知,您希望使容器可以访问您机器上的wildFly主页。为此,您可以将主机上的wildfly目录绑定到容器上

docker run -v <path-to-folder-on-host>:<path-in-container> ...
docker运行-v:。。。
这将把机器上的文件夹装载到指定位置的容器上